Wine history
chevron-down

In 1994, Roland and Karin Lenz opened a new chapter in winegrowing in Iselisberg (TG) – as pioneers of organic wine in German-speaking Switzerland. The road was rocky, but they persevered with determination and a clear vision. Since 2006, the winery has been working exclusively organically and is now Demeter-certified. Over 30 PIWI varieties grow on 22 hectares – an expression of diversity and an innovative connection to nature. The multi-award-winning winery stands for distinctive organic wines with character.

Tasting note
chevron-down

The nose reveals dark forest berries, complemented by subtle notes of liquorice and a hint of pepper. On the palate, it is full-bodied with smooth tannins and a lingering finish – a well-rounded, inviting red wine with character.
